Seeing the good reviews I was excited to check this place out and was disappointed, mainly by the food. The pomegranate chicken was drowned in a sweet sauce and was way overcooked. The mashed potatoes were surprisingly sour tasting and I couldn’t eat them. The only thing I liked was the Moussaka, but it also had bad mashed potatoes that weren’t creamy. I’m not sure if it was a bad day, but I was disappointed. The atmosphere and waitress were nice though.

We were going to a Civic Center concert but had not booked in Hayes Valley, so we looked on line for a SF restaurant that had a vacancy at our desired time. This one is not at all near the Civic Center but was among those we found and i really liked the white table cloths and the type of food in their writeup. Greek/Mediterranean food is the best. Parking is difficult but we allowed ten minutes of hunting and got lucky to find a parking place a block and a half away. At 6:00 p.m. they no longer ticket cars, so we parked and got lucky with ten minutes to go. /The food was really good and enough that we took back a portion to reheat for the next days' dinner. The only negative is parking so either take a Venmo or allow enough time for parking. The streets around are all flat so even if you had to walk many blocks it won't be hard to get there by foot after you park.

We celebrated my birthday on January 2, 2025. Appetizers included delicious hummus, crunchy calamari, and warm dolmas. My wife's entree was a chilled Caesar salad. I chose a Mediterranean salad with a skewer of grilled shrimp. Everything was delicious and served promptly. The dining room ceiling is painted blue with white clouds, which reminded us of our visits to Santorini. The restaurant recognized my birthday with a complementary Baklava pastry. Most appreciated!
